The Ministry of Science and ICT stated, "The number of 5G locations nationwide doubled to 54 last year."

As of the end of 2023, 54 locations across 30 companies and institutions
Utilized in 14 fields including manufacturing, healthcare, logistics, and education.

Over the past year, the number of users of the 5G specialized network (Eum 5G) has doubled compared to the previous year.

The Ministry of Science and ICT announced on the 3rd that the use of 5G has more than doubled compared to the previous year, expanding to 54 locations across 30 companies and organizations nationwide as of the end of 2023.

"Eum5G (5G specialized network)" is a communications network that utilizes 5G frequencies in specific areas, allowing non-mobile carriers to implement their own networks. Its goal is to actively leverage the benefits of 5G mobile communications in specific areas, such as land and buildings.

In December 2021, Naver Cloud became the first domestic operator to receive a frequency allocation and launch the service. In 2022, 26 locations across nine sectors, including manufacturing, healthcare, and logistics, began using the service. By 2023, the service had expanded to 54 locations across 14 sectors, including automotive, shipbuilding, steel, and education, expanding its reach across all industries. Currently, there are 18 ‘frequency allocation’ companies and 12 ‘frequency designation’ companies.

According to industry experts, there will be 2,900 5G-specific networks worldwide by the end of 2023, and this is expected to grow at an average annual rate of 33% to reach 11,900 by 2028.

Meanwhile, Korea has also been streamlining the application process and submission requirements for 5G to promote its adoption. This includes streamlining the application process and removing restrictions on foreign ownership when registering as a fixed-line telecommunications business. Furthermore, a website has been established to provide comprehensive information, including the latest domestic and international deployment cases and the status of equipment and terminal supply. Furthermore, on-site pre-registration consulting services have been provided to address frequency application procedures and provide technical support.

The Ministry of Science and ICT presented references through 15 demonstration projects to ensure that 5G can be utilized in various fields. Last December, the domestic research team ETRI also achieved the success of completing the development of technology that increased the speed of 5G small cells to 3 Gbps.

Major examples of 5G services include: △Manufacturing: Increased productivity through stable and fast data processing compared to Wi-Fi, and major accident prevention services through real-time control △Logistics: Increased work efficiency through fast and safe data processing of personal digital assistants (PDAs) △Autonomous robots: A service in which AI autonomous robots deliver lunch boxes, drinks, mail, parcels, etc. to individuals in the office △Medical: Precision surgery services through 3D augmented reality (3D AR) and real-time non-face-to-face collaboration based on the results of patients’ computed tomography (CT)/magnetic resonance imaging (MRI) at hospitals △Defense: Multilateral collaborative combat based on realistic virtual reality (VR) using 28GHz, military training services such as mortar/anti-aircraft weapon operation and combat, etc.

In the future, as digital technologies such as artificial intelligence (AI), virtual models (digital twins), augmented reality (AR), extended reality (XR), and extended virtual worlds (metaverse) are linked with 5G to provide customized convergence services to demand companies, digital technology suppliers are also expected to grow in the market along with 5G.

The Ministry of Science and ICT plans to cooperate with 5G operators this year to actively utilize advanced 5G convergence services in large-scale logistics sites and energy sectors. In addition, we will work with relevant ministries and local governments to apply 5G to realistic content such as specialized training using extended reality (XR) and safety areas such as preventing major accidents in intelligent factories.

Hong Jin-bae, Director of the Network Policy Bureau at the Ministry of Science and ICT, said, “Ieum 5G is being successfully implemented by supporting the customized needs of users who want to implement various services in various industries,” and added, “We will continue to create successful cases that contribute to improving public convenience and revitalizing industries through various Ieum 5G services with large-capacity hyper-connectivity.”
